Learning outcomes
The aim of this course is to introduce the students of special education into the subject of sociology. Contents of the course include issues as the socialization, social norms, social stratification, social inequalities, gender and racism. After completing the course, students will understand terms such as sociological imagination and sociological paradigm. They will also be shortly acquainted with the sociological classics as Durkhem, Marx and Weber.
